While filming the Orange walk scenes, the cast and crew were occasionally met with opposition from angry locals who were throwing objects towards the parade.
The Orange Order is a conservative British unionist organisation with links to Ulster loyalism. As a strict Protestant society, it does not accept non-Protestants as members. Marches through mainly Catholic and Irish nationalist neighborhoods are controversial and have often led to violence.
While driving out of Derry there is a lanyard of yellow and green around the rear view mirror in Gerry's car, these are colours for Donegal in GAA. Tommy Tiernan who plays Gerry was born in Donegal.
